Hitachi ZX850-3 Fault Code 11998-3: Complete Diagnostic Guide
What is Hitachi ZX850-3 Fault Code 11998-3?
Fault Code 11998-3 indicates a communication error or abnormal signal from the machine monitoring system, specifically related to the controller area network (CAN) communication line between the engine ECM (Engine Control Module) and the monitor controller. This code is part of Hitachi's proprietary diagnostic system for the ZX850-3 excavator series.
The CAN bus serves as the central nervous system for modern excavators, allowing critical components like the engine ECM, hydraulic controller, and display monitor to exchange real-time data. When this communication pathway fails, the machine cannot properly coordinate engine performance with hydraulic demands, potentially leading to reduced efficiency or complete operational shutdown. For the ZX850-3's Isuzu engine platform, maintaining reliable CAN communication is essential for optimal fuel management and emissions control.
Common Symptoms
- Warning light illumination on the instrument cluster, often accompanied by a "Check Engine" or system malfunction indicator
- Intermittent or complete loss of gauge readings (engine RPM, coolant temperature, fuel level) on the monitor display
- Reduced engine power or derate mode activation as the ECM enters a failsafe state
- Erratic hydraulic response due to disrupted communication between engine load sensing and hydraulic demand
- Inability to access diagnostic information through the standard monitor interface
Potential Causes
- Corroded or damaged CAN bus connectors, particularly at the ECM harness connection points exposed to engine bay heat and vibration
- Wiring harness chafing at known rub points near the engine mount brackets or along the right-hand chassis rail
- Failed termination resistors within the CAN network (typically 120-ohm resistors at network endpoints)
- ECM or monitor controller internal failure, more common in high-hour used machines (8,000+ hours)
- Voltage supply issues to either controller due to corroded ground connections or failing main relay
- Aftermarket component interference from improperly installed accessories tapping into the CAN network
How to Troubleshoot and Fix Code 11998-3
Step 1: Visual Inspection Begin with a thorough inspection of all wiring harnesses between the engine ECM (located on the right side of the engine) and the cab monitor controller. On used excavators, pay special attention to harness routing near the engine mounts and turbocharger area where heat damage is common. Check all connector pins for corrosion, bent terminals, or moisture intrusion.
Step 2: Electrical Testing Using a digital multimeter, verify CAN-High and CAN-Low voltage at the ECM connector. With ignition on and engine off, you should measure approximately 2.5V on CAN-High and 2.5V on CAN-Low (differential voltage near 0V at rest). Check for proper termination resistance by measuring between CAN-High and CAN-Low with all controllers disconnected—you should read approximately 60 ohms (two 120-ohm resistors in parallel).
Step 3: Component Testing Connect Hitachi Dr.EX diagnostic software or compatible scan tool to access live CAN bus data. Monitor for communication dropouts or error frames. Test battery voltage at both the ECM and monitor controller—should be 24V±2V. Inspect all ground connections, particularly G101 (engine ground) and G201 (frame ground), cleaning and retightening as needed.
Step 4: Harness and Connector Repair For used machines, replace any connectors showing corrosion rather than attempting to clean them. Apply dielectric grease to all CAN bus connections. If harness damage is found, repair using proper twisted-pair shielded cable maintaining the original wire gauge and shielding integrity.
